Output 574dc8b1bb683f20dbd176c6567818352a2b8a2f00700f781c05da5fa8800945:1

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37627b7b75a75df0401d904e07f216b828b05 OP_EQUAL
address
3BMEXh1GPeYrewDpACPCm4oLLho2YugiEy
transaction
574dc8b1bb683f20dbd176c6567818352a2b8a2f00700f781c05da5fa8800945
confirmations
307908
spent
true